Preview
Building Options: How a Utah program is helping increase homeownership opportunities Amid a housing crisis, four cities are finding success in Utah’s moderate-income housing program to spur construction and improve affordability.

From Millcreek to Vernal to Hurricane, strategies enacted that help cities comply with a state program are leading to more housing for people making 80% or less of the median wage.

Here's the first of a five-part series.
